Установка и настройка
1. В консоли на сервере выполните команду, которая скачает установочный скрипт.
curl -O https://www.isplicense.ru/install_module.sh
Предоставьте скрипту права на выполнение.
chmod 755 install_module.sh
2. Запустите скрипт, указав через пробел название модуля и ключ (Key), полученный после покупки.
./install_module.sh LAVA
После успешной установки модуля скрипт выдаст сообщение «Модуль успешно установлен!»
3. В личном кабинете LAVA необходимо сгенерировать API ключ (JWT токен).
4. Под админом в BILLmanager в разделе «Методы оплаты» добавьте метод LAVA. Настройте метод, заполнив необходимые поля.
При желании вы можете закачать иконки платежной системы в настройках метода оплаты:
LAVA icon 32x32; LAVA icon 30x35
Если при добавлении нового метода оплаты не появилась форма конфигурации модуля, то необходимо выполнить в консоли на сервере команду, которая перезапустит биллинг:
killall core
Модуль готов к работе. Перед запуском модуля в боевой режим, рекомендуем провести тестовый платеж.
При обращении в поддержку прикладывайте файл с логом модуля, который можно найти тут: /usr/local/mgr5/var/pmlava.log
Справочно:
Установочный скрипт выполняет следующие действия:
- Проверка PHP и наличия необходимых PHP модулей
- Проверка расположения PHP
- Скачивание архива с модулем
- Распаковка архива с модулем и копирование файлов модуля в папку биллинга
- Предоставление файлам прав на выполнение.
- Удаление временно созданных файлов
- Перезагрузка биллинга